										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<img width="400" height="200" src="https://www.youngisthan.in/wp-content/uploads/cmsimported/img-54126ac769f17-posts-8793-400x200.jpg" class="attachment-medium size-medium wp-post-image" alt="" style="float:left; margin:0 15px 15px 0;" srcset="https://www.youngisthan.in/wp-content/uploads/cmsimported/img-54126ac769f17-posts-8793-400x200.jpg 400w, https://www.youngisthan.in/wp-content/uploads/cmsimported/img-54126ac769f17-posts-8793-200x100.jpg 200w, https://www.youngisthan.in/wp-content/uploads/cmsimported/img-54126ac769f17-posts-8793.jpg 800w" sizes="(max-width: 400px) 100vw, 400px" /><p>There&rsquo;s always a lot of nostalgia which comes to surface whenever we see a child actor all grown up on the big screen.</p>
<p>Primarily, because you&rsquo;ve seen them as innocent, cute kids on the silver screen, doing the usual antics of a small child.</p>
<p>Few years pass by in a jiffy&hellip;</p>
<p>Now, &nbsp;they are not only grown up, but also you find them doing some serious acting on the celluloid.</p>
<p>And of course, in such a scenario you just can&rsquo;t believe that they are the same small kiddo.</p>
<p>Here are 9 Bollywod child actors who grew up to be really unrecognizable.</p>
<p><strong>1). &nbsp;Hansika Motwani</strong></p>
<p>She played one of the kids in Hrithik Roshan&rsquo;s gang in the movie Koi Mil Gaya.&nbsp;And within a few years she was all grown up and starring opposite none other than Himesh Reshammiya.</p>
<p><img src="https://www.youngisthan.in/userfiles/child-actors-of-bollywood/1.jpg" alt="1" width="748" height="374" /></p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p><strong>2). &nbsp;Kunal Khemu</strong></p>
<p>He did a splendid job in Mahesh Bhatt&rsquo;s Zakhm as a child actor and well, then he grew up!&nbsp;He was appreciated in his comeback flick Kalyug, but since then he&rsquo;s been struggling hard for success.</p>
<p><img src="https://www.youngisthan.in/userfiles/child-actors-of-bollywood/2.jpg" alt="2" width="748" height="374" /></p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p><strong>3). &nbsp;Shweta Basu Prasad</strong></p>
<p>This talented actor has been awarded with National Award for Best Child Artist category for Vishal Bharadwaj&rsquo;s Makdee.&nbsp;It&rsquo;s really unfortunate how she was caught and defamed by the media in a prostitution scandal last week.</p>
<p><img src="https://www.youngisthan.in/userfiles/child-actors-of-bollywood/3.jpg" alt="3" width="748" height="374" /></p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p><strong>4). &nbsp;Jugal Hansraj</strong></p>
<p>He was beyond cuteness in Masoom. While he continued to look equally handsome when he grew up, he became a heartthrob overnight, because of his role in comeback flick Mohabbatein.</p>
<p><img src="https://www.youngisthan.in/userfiles/child-actors-of-bollywood/4.jpg" alt="4" width="748" height="374" /></p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p><strong>5). &nbsp;Urmila Matondkar</strong></p>
<p>She too acted as a child actor in Masoom, and was quite good at the craft. The entire nation witnessed the elegance of this hot damsel in Rangeela and thereafter.</p>
<p><img src="https://www.youngisthan.in/userfiles/child-actors-of-bollywood/5.jpg" alt="5" width="748" height="374" /></p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p><strong>6). &nbsp;Sana Saeed</strong></p>
<p>Okay, so we all know this one. I mean,&nbsp; no one can forget Shah Rukh&rsquo;s cute, little daughter in Kuch Kuch Hota Hai? Of course, we all remember her hot avatar in Karan Johar&rsquo;s Student Of The Year.</p>
<p><img src="https://www.youngisthan.in/userfiles/child-actors-of-bollywood/6.jpg" alt="6" width="748" height="374" /></p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p><strong>7). &nbsp;Aftab Shivdasani</strong></p>
<p>He was one of the child actors in the ever-famous Mr. India. His comeback as a grown up actor opposite Urmila in Mast, was sizzling. That&rsquo;s another thing, if his career didn&rsquo;t take off well.</p>
<p>&nbsp;<img src="https://www.youngisthan.in/userfiles/child-actors-of-bollywood/7.jpg" alt="7" width="748" height="374" /></p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p><strong>8). &nbsp;Aditya Narayan</strong></p>
<p>He played one of the kids in then gang in the movie Pardes, and even sang for one the songs as a kid in the movie Taal. He grew up, tried his luck in acting with Vikram Bhatt&rsquo;s Shaapit, and figured it&rsquo;s best to return back to singing!</p>
<p><img src="https://www.youngisthan.in/userfiles/child-actors-of-bollywood/8.jpg" alt="8" width="748" height="374" /></p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p><strong>9). &nbsp;Parzan Dastur</strong></p>
<p>Last but not the least, how can you ever forget the star counting, cute looking kid in Kuch Kuch Hota Hai! Let&rsquo;s admit, we all were really shocked when we saw him all grown up, doing some serious acting 2009 flick Sikandar.</p>
<p><img src="https://www.youngisthan.in/userfiles/child-actors-of-bollywood/9.jpg" alt="9" width="748" height="374" /></p>
<p>Every child actor is lovable, be it for their innocence or for their playful nature.<br />However, destiny is also a factor that plays an important part in shaping our lives.</p>
<p>May be they were not destined to be super stars!</p>
